The Health department has withdrawn all the surveillance steps in ward 5 of Ramanattukara municipality in Kozhikode district from where a Nipah case was reported in June.
A release from the office of Health Minister K. Muraleedharan said on Wednesday (July 22, 2026) that no new cases had been reported from there in the past 42 days. Meanwhile, the condition of the 43-year-old infected person, who is being treated at the Government Medical College Hospital (MCH), Kozhikode, is improving. His ventilator support has been taken off and he has tested negative for the virus thrice in recent weeks.
